How to Register and Verify Your Account

Getting started with Skycrown Casino is as easy as filling out a short form. You’ll need a valid email address, a password you can remember (but not too simple), and your date of birth to confirm you’re over 18. Once the form is submitted, a verification email lands in your inbox – click the link and you’re in the lobby.

Before you can withdraw real money, the casino will ask for a few documents to satisfy KYC (Know Your Customer) rules. Typical requests are a scanned photo‑ID, a utility bill and sometimes a credit‑card statement. Upload these through the “Verification” tab, and most players see approval within 24‑48 hours. The whole process feels a bit bureaucratic, but it protects you from fraud and keeps the casino compliant.

Bonuses, Promotions and Wagering Requirements

Skycrown offers a welcome package that includes a 100 % match bonus up to AU$500 plus 50 free spins on selected slots. The match bonus comes with a 30× wagering requirement on the bonus amount, while the free spins winnings are subject to a 40× requirement. Those numbers are pretty standard for Australian online casinos, but make sure you read the fine print – some games contribute less than 100 % to the wagering.

Beyond the first deposit, the casino runs weekly reload bonuses, cash‑back offers and a loyalty points scheme. Reloads usually give 25 % up to AU$200 with a 25× wagering condition, while cash‑back is calculated on net losses and credited every Monday. Keep an eye on the “Promotions” page; the offers rotate, and the best deals often appear on special holidays.

Deposit and Withdrawal Methods for Aussie Players

Australian players have a decent selection of local‑friendly payment options. The most common deposit methods are credit/debit cards (Visa, Mastercard), PayPal, POLi and direct bank transfer via BPAY. Deposits are processed instantly, so you can jump straight into a game after confirming the amount.

When it comes to cashing out, the same methods are available, but the speed varies. PayPal and POLi usually deliver funds within 24 hours, while bank transfers can take 3–5 business days. Skycrown advertises “instant payouts” for e‑wallets, but the final timing still depends on the bank’s processing window. The minimum withdrawal is AU$20 and the maximum per transaction is AU$2,000.
